1. Windows系统: 如果你是通过MySQL Installer安装的,数据库文件通常位于`C:ProgramDataMySQLMySQL Server 8.0Data`。 如果你是通过手动安装的,数据库文件通常位于`C:Program FilesMySQLMySQL Server 8.0data`。

2. Linux系统: 数据库文件通常位于`/var/lib/mysql/`。

3. macOS系统: 数据库文件通常位于`/usr/local/mysql/data/`。

请注意,这些位置可能会因MySQL的版本和配置而有所不同。如果你不确定数据库文件的确切位置,你可以使用以下命令来查找:

```bashmysql help | grep 'Default options'```

这个命令会显示MySQL的默认选项,其中包括数据库文件的路径。另外,你还可以在MySQL的配置文件(通常是`my.cnf`或`my.ini`)中查找`datadir`选项来确认数据库文件的位置。

MySQL数据库文件存放位置详解

在学习和使用MySQL数据库的过程中,了解数据库文件的存放位置是非常重要的。这不仅有助于我们更好地管理和维护数据库,还能在遇到问题时快速定位和解决问题。本文将详细介绍MySQL数据库文件的存放位置,帮助您更好地掌握这一知识点。

一、MySQL数据库文件概述

MySQL数据库文件主要包括以下几类:

数据文件:存储数据库中的实际数据。

索引文件:存储数据表的索引信息,用于加速数据查询。

日志文件:记录数据库的运行状态,包括错误日志、慢查询日志、二进制日志等。

配置文件:存储MySQL服务器的配置信息。

二、MySQL数据库文件存放位置

MySQL数据库文件的存放位置取决于安装方式和操作系统。以下分别介绍Windows和Linux系统下MySQL数据库文件的存放位置。

1. Windows系统

在Windows系统中,MySQL数据库文件的默认存放位置为:

C:\\Program Files\\MySQL\\MySQL Server x.x\\data

其中,x.x代表您安装的MySQL版本号。如果安装时选择了自定义路径,则数据库文件将存放在指定的路径中。

2. Linux系统

在Linux系统中,MySQL数据库文件的默认存放位置为:

/var/lib/mysql

此外,一些Linux发行版可能将MySQL数据库文件存放在其他路径,如:

/usr/local/mysql/data

/usr/share/mysql/data

具体存放位置取决于您的Linux发行版和MySQL安装方式。

三、如何查看MySQL数据库文件存放位置

如果您不确定MySQL数据库文件的存放位置,可以通过以下方法进行查看:

1. 使用命令行工具

在Windows系统中,打开命令提示符,输入以下命令:

mysql -u root -p

然后输入密码登录MySQL服务器。登录成功后,执行以下命令查看数据目录:

SHOW VARIABLES LIKE 'datadir';

在Linux系统中,打开终端,输入以下命令:

mysql -u root -p

然后输入密码登录MySQL服务器。登录成功后,执行以下命令查看数据目录:

SHOW VARIABLES LIKE 'datadir';

2. 使用图形界面工具

如果您使用的是MySQL Workbench等图形界面工具,可以在工具中查看数据库文件的存放位置。具体操作如下:

打开MySQL Workbench,连接到MySQL服务器。

在左侧导航栏中,选择“服务器”。

在右侧窗口中,找到“数据目录”一项,即可查看数据库文件的存放位置。

了解MySQL数据库文件的存放位置对于数据库的管理和维护至关重要。本文详细介绍了MySQL数据库文件在Windows和Linux系统下的存放位置,以及如何查看数据库文件的存放位置。希望本文能帮助您更好地掌握这一知识点。

MySQL数据库,数据库文件存放位置,Windows系统,Linux系统,MySQL版本号,MySQL Workbench